Back in October, when we launched the new design, we said we were taking this to the next level. Well today we build upon that, with another feature of Smoking Apples. I’m so very pleased to introduce to you, the Smoking Apples Magazine.

When we launched the new design, it became apparent to us that people wanted to dig through our content looking for more interesting articles. However, due to the nature of the internet, and problems with making that information easily accessible, the most that users went through were the featured posts. So we decided that every month, we compile our best posts, in a stunning professional quality eMag would solve this problem. A little over two weeks later, we’re out with our first issue.
So what’s the deal with the magazine then? Here’s a little disclaimer from the magazine itself:
“This eMag is free to distribute by any medium. You can print it, email it, upload it on your web server, or share it on a p2p network if you will. You may however not edit any part of this PDF, copy the content, or split the pages. This PDF must remain whole at all times.
Smoking Apples is in no way associated with Apple, Inc., any software company, or person mentioned in this magazine, the website, or anywhere else. We are a totally independent in our news, views, and hold our journalistic integrity to the highest. Our views cannot be bought.”
